D.GNAK Spearheads Monochromatic Silhouettes for Fall/Winter 2018

Focusing on unconventional constructions.

Kang Dong Jun of D.GNAK opted for a simplistic color palette to go along with avant grade tailoring in the silhouettes presented at his Fall/Winter 2018 presentation for London Fashion Week Men’s. Swathed in black and white hues, the fledgling South Korean imprint showcased varsity jackets with embroidered skull motifs, leather jackets, long-coats, flowy suiting, high-waisted trousers, and sizable knitted belts. Not to mention, a slew of high-top sneakers with bulky midsoles were spotted at the runway show as well.
